About The Position

The Ohio Department of Behavioral Health (DBH) is seeking an Alcohol and Drug Counselor 2 to join their Central Ohio Behavioral Healthcare team. This role involves providing direct counseling services to individuals with alcohol and other drug dependencies, from intake through discharge. The position is part of a treatment team and requires comprehensive case management, crisis intervention, and detailed documentation. Responsibilities

  • Conduct interviews & provide counseling services to alcohol & other drug dependent patients/clients
  • Facilitate screening and interviewing of patients/clients from intake to discharge
  • Delivers direct services including facilitating of group & individual therapy
  • Perform overall case management & crisis intervention
  • Develop client treatment plans & ensure compliance with applicable standards, agency policies & administrative regulations & institutional rules
  • Monitors clients’ progress in treatment; maintains clinical case records, documentation, and case files
  • Refer clients to community programs and resources. Works closely with AA/NA volunteers.
  • Participate as part of treatment team (planning meetings, case presentation and discussions, and provides services in accordance with principles of a therapeutic community)
  • Complete & maintain accurate and timely documentation and reports
  • Maintain knowledge and adherence to compliance requirements for Joint Commission, ODBH, and COBH.
  • Attend staff meetings, trainings, and conferences as required
